The Property
This fabulous family home has been skilfully and thoughtfully extended and adapted to now provide generous accommodation arranged over three floors. The current vendors have improved the property beyond recognition from its original state, with benefits including gas central heating with a replaced boiler, and UPVC double glazing.
A spacious hallway opens through to the sitting room, which provides a lovely space for relaxing. The open-plan ‘living’ kitchen is fitted with a range of base and wall units and integrated appliances. There are patio doors that lead to the garden and roof lanterns flooding the space with natural light. To complete the ground floor, there is a useful utility room and WC.
The upper floors boast four double bedrooms split over the first and second floors, the principal bedroom having fitted wardrobes and an ensuite. Bedroom three also boasts an ensuite, and finally there is the main bathroom.
The Outside
Outside, the property occupies a delightful, south-westerly facing plot which makes the most of the afternoon and evening sun. There is a driveway to the front providing parking and access to the garage.
To the rear, the garden has been landscaped with a decked seating terrace, a stoned patio, and shaped lawns. There are well-stocked and established borders, and trees provide the perfect canopy for shade. With fencing to boundaries and gated side access.
